Introduction to Cutting Mixer Machine

A cutting mixer machine is a professional-grade food processing unit combining high-speed cutting blades with mixing capabilities. These machines handle raw materials such as vegetables, meat, herbs, sauces, dough, and pastes, delivering fast and uniform processing results. Cutting mixer machines reduce manual workloads while maintaining quality and texture consistency in finished products. Their multi-functional design allows them to replace several standalone tools, optimizing commercial kitchen and factory workflows.


Why Use Cutting Mixer Machines?

  • Time Efficiency: Automated cutting and mixing significantly reduce preparation and processing time compared to manual methods.
  • Consistency: Uniform blade action and controlled mixing parameters ensure consistent texture and product quality. 
  • Versatility: One machine can perform chopping, mixing, emulsifying, and blending tasks without changing equipment. 
  • Reduced Labor Costs: By automating labor-intensive processes, operational labor requirements are minimized.
  • Scalability: Suitable for small commercial kitchens up to large-scale production lines.

Technical Specifications and Key Parameters

Understanding the technical details of a cutting mixer machine is essential when evaluating equipment performance and suitability. Below is a typical specification template used in commercial food processing equipment:

Specification Typical Value / Range
Power Source Electric (220V–380V options)
Motor Power 0.5 kW – 15 kW (varies by model)
Blade Speed 500–1500+ rpm
Capacity 20–150+ liters
Material Stainless Steel Body & Bowl
Functions Cutting, Mixing, Emulsifying, Blending
Control Modes Manual / Touch Panel Options

These parameters ensure that a cutting mixer can handle continuous operation under high-load conditions while maintaining durability and safety.


Typical Applications in Food Processing

Cutting mixer machines find broad use across commercial kitchens, food manufacturers, bakeries, and catering operations due to their multifunctionality and efficiency:

  • Production of sauces, dressings, and purees
  • Meat and vegetable chopping for processed foods
  • Homogenizing emulsions for condiments
  • Dough mixing for bakery applications
  • Preparation of pet food, soups, and ready meals

Their adaptability makes them suitable for both continuous and batch operations, addressing diverse product categories in modern food production.

Cutting Mixer Machine FAQ

Q: What materials can a cutting mixer handle?

A: Cutting mixer machines can process vegetables, meat, herbs, sauces, dough, and emulsions due to their high-speed rotary blades and robust mixing design. 

Q: Is the cutting mixer suitable for commercial-scale production?

Q: How does blade speed impact performance?

A: Higher blade speeds typically result in finer cutting and faster mixing, which improves texture consistency and reduces processing time, particularly for pastes and emulsions.

Q: Are cutting mixer machines safe for food processing?

A: Yes. Commercial units feature safety interlocks and durable stainless steel construction, which helps meet food safety and hygiene requirements when properly cleaned.

Q: Do cutting mixer machines require special maintenance?

A: Regular blade sharpening, lubrication of mechanical parts, and cleaning after each use are recommended to sustain performance and longevity.
